Interchangeability of Siemens and GE Breakers

The good news is that Siemens breakers can generally replace GE breakers. However, it’s crucial to ensure that the Siemens breaker matches the amp and voltage ratings of the original GE breaker. This compatibility ensures that the electrical system operates safely and efficiently.

Here are some key points to consider:

  • Matching Ratings: Always match the amp and voltage ratings of the breakers. Mismatched ratings can lead to electrical failures or fires.
  • UL-Classification: Use UL-classified breakers to ensure safety and compliance with industry standards.
  • Manufacturer Guidelines: Refer to the manufacturer’s compatibility charts and guidelines to confirm compatibility.

Installation Tips

Step-by-Step Guide

Replacing a GE breaker with a Siemens breaker involves several steps to ensure safety and proper installation. Here’s a simplified guide:

  1. Turn Off the Main Power: Ensure the main power supply is turned off before starting any work.
  2. Remove the Panel Cover: Carefully remove the panel cover to access the breakers.
  3. Identify the Breaker to Be Replaced: Locate the GE breaker that needs to be replaced.
  4. Remove the Old Breaker: Gently remove the old GE breaker from the panel.
  5. Install the Siemens Breaker: Insert the Siemens breaker into the same slot, ensuring a secure fit.
  6. Check Connections: Verify that all connections are tight and secure.
  7. Replace the Panel Cover: Once the new breaker is installed, replace the panel cover.
  8. Turn On the Main Power: Restore the main power supply and test the new breaker to ensure it’s functioning correctly.

Safety Precautions

  • Always Turn Off Power: Ensure the main power supply is turned off before starting any electrical work.
  • Use Proper Tools: Use appropriate tools and safety equipment.
  • Consult a Professional: If unsure, consult a professional electrician to perform the replacement.

Can Siemens breakers replace GE breakers in all panels? Yes, Siemens breakers can replace GE breakers in most panels, provided they have matching amp and voltage ratings. However, always check the specific compatibility for your panel and follow manufacturer guidelines to ensure safety.

What should I do if I cannot find the exact replacement breaker? If you cannot find the exact replacement breaker, consult compatibility charts or a professional electrician. Using a compatible breaker with the same ratings is essential to maintain the safety and functionality of your electrical system.

How can I identify the correct breaker for my panel? To identify the correct breaker for your panel:

  1. Check the Panel Label: Look for a label inside your electrical panel indicating compatible breakers.
  2. Refer to Compatibility Charts: Use online resources or manufacturer-provided compatibility charts.
  3. Consult a Professional: If in doubt, a professional electrician can provide the necessary advice and ensure you choose the right breaker.

Are there any brands that are always compatible with GE breakers? Brands such as Siemens, Eaton, Cutler-Hammer, Murray, and Westinghouse often have compatible breakers with GE panels. However, it’s crucial to verify compatibility for each specific breaker and panel combination.
